Formalisation of Quantitative UML models Using Continuous Time Markov Chains.
Résumé
In this paper, a quantitative modelling with UML is presented and a translation from concurrent extended UML statecharts into continuous time Markov chains (CTMCs) is proposed. These are widely used in the context of performance and reliability evaluation of various systems. Our aim is to carry out a probabilistic model checking of properties related to dependability of probabilistic systems. A semantics based on stochastic clocks is used to easily translate from UML statecharts augmented with stochastic time to CTMCs. Temporal probabilistic properties related to system dependability are specified with continuous stochastic logic (CSL).
